Center Stage Ashburn Preschool Classes: Our Most Frequently Asked Questions

We’ve got answers to some of the most frequently asked questions!

What are Your Hours?

Center Stage is open from 6:30am – 6:30pm for full day child care, morning preschool, or afternoon preschool.

Do you offer half days & full days?

We offer Morning and Afternoon Preschool classes as well as full day child care. Your child can even attend 2, 3, or 5 days/week!

Does my child need to be potty trained?

We understand that there are accidents but children need to be potty trained for the most part to attend our facility.

What are the safety certifications for your staff?

All of the staff members at Center Stage Preschool are CPR and First Aid Certified. Our lead teachers are MAT Certified and our Director is FEMA Certified.

What is the student/teacher ratio?

Despite the 10/1 ratio required, we employ a 7/1 ratio to make sure our students get the attention and care that they deserve.

What is your food allergy policy?

Center Stage Preschool is a nut free facility. This is one of the main reasons we have all meals and snacks catered. If parents need to provide food for their child they must comply with this policy.

Do you have cameras monitoring your facility?

Center Stage Preschool absolutely has cameras monitoring at all times. Once your child is enrolled in our program you will be given access to our secure system where you will have the ability to check in to see exactly what your child is doing at any give time during the day.

How often does my child go outside?

Children go outside two times per day at Center Stage Preschool. Once in the morning and once in the afternoon. Each outdoor session lasts up to 45 minutes (weather permitting).

How much time will my child spend on an electronic tablet?

Answer? None!  Center Stage Preschool is a technology free zone. Lead teachers use tablets to communicate with parents sending updates and photos. Otherwise there are no personal cell phones or tablets available for use at any time.

How do you handle behavioral issues?

Center Stage Preschool uses a unique approach when a child is not behaving the way they should. We use a 3 step approach: Model, Redirect, Glue.
First we model good behavior, secondly redirect their attention and finally, we essentially glue them to the teacher’s side to help with tasks. We will contact the parent if the behavior continues.

Who provides lunch?

Center Stage Preschool gets all lunches and snacks catered from School House Grill. We are able to accommodate special dietary/religious needs on a case by case basis.

Do you operate year round?

Center Stage Preschool is open year round. We are a preschool but also a full day child care facility to accommodate those families who need care year round.

How often do you do firedrills?

At Center Stage Preschool we do firedrills two times per month and safety drills for other situations twice a year.

Do I have to wait for a specific month to enroll?

At Center Stage Preschool there is no need to wait for a specific month to enroll. We have an open enrollment policy so you can enroll any time as long as your child fits our 3-6 year old age requirement.

What is your vacation policy?

If you need to pause your child’s tuition for time off for vacation, all we ask is a two week notice so that we can pause your payments.

Can I extend the number of days my child attends?

You can absolutely extend the number of days your child attends Center Stage Preschool. As long as there is room on the days you are interested in we are happy to accommodate your family! We offer 2, 3, and 5 day/week programs.

Do you provide beds for naps?

We most certainly do provide a mat for your child to lay on for nap time. We only ask that you provide clean linens.
